Lefebvre in English:Hard-Hitting May '76 Talk in ResponseTo Attack by Paul VIhttp://www.blogtalkradio.com/restorationradio/2014/01/04/from-the-pulpit-xviii-archbishop-lefebvres-1976-conference-1(You can download this one to your hard drive.)During the most intense period of his public battle with Paul VI over Vatican II, shortly before the beginning of what would be called "The Hot Summer" of '76, and six weeks before he ordained Detroit native Daniel Dolan to the priesthood, Archbishop Marcel Lefebvre gave a rousing public conference to a gathering of faithful Catholics in the U.S.In May 1976 Paul VI launched another public attack against Abp. Lefebrve, and the archbishop read about it in the New York Times when he was visiting with Frs. Clarence Kelly and Donald Sanborn at the SSPX residence at East Meadow NY. The conference was given in response to that attack.It hit all the classic Lefebvre themes, and openly attacked the modernists for conspiring to hijack Vatican II, spreading the condemned error of religious liberty, overthrowing the Kingship of Christ, embracing Marxism, protestantizing the liturgy, uprooting faith in the real presence, and utterly destroying the Catholic priesthood.The archbishop's conference is a condemnation of Vatican II, root and branch, for all the evil it inflicted on the Church.
